Transportation Overview in Eagle River

Eagle River is a small city with a strong reliance on personal vehicles. Public transit options are limited, making car ownership a common necessity.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What is the average cost of car insurance in Eagle River?

Average car insurance costs in Eagle River align with state averages. Factors include driving history, vehicle type, and coverage level.

2. Are there any public transportation options available?

Public transportation is limited, with a few bus routes serving the area. Most residents rely on personal vehicles for daily commutes.

3. How much can I expect to spend on fuel monthly?

Monthly fuel costs will vary based on driving habits. On average, residents might spend anywhere from $100 to $200 depending on usage.

4. Is biking a viable option for transportation?

Biking can be enjoyable, especially in summer. However, during winter months, snow and ice can make it unsafe.

5. What are the parking costs like in the city?

Parking is generally free in residential areas and often available in commercial zones. However, check for any restrictions during winter months.
